    Viqueens right ship for consolation win
    By RICKEY CLARDY - For the T-G
    What a difference a game makes. After not scoring for the final five minutes in a semifinal loss to Forrest the night before, the Community Viqueens were clicking on all cylinders as the Viqueens built a 24-point halftime lead en route to a 62-39 victory over the Giles County Lady Bobcats in the consolation matchup of the District 12-AA tournament Wednesday night...

    Late cold spell dooms Viqueens
    By RICKEY CLARDY ~ For the T-G
    UNIONVILLE – The Community Viqueens led with 5:30 to play but were held scoreless the rest of the way as the Forrest Lady Rockets scored the final 11 points of the game to defeat the Viqueens 49-41 in the semifinals of the District 12-AA tournament Tuesday night...
  • Offense a struggle for Eaglettes in season ending loss
    T-G STAFF REPORT
    LAWRENCEBURG – Points were hard to come by for Shelbyville Central’s Golden Eaglettes in a 56-38 loss to Lawrence County on the road in the opening round of the District 8-AAA Tournament on Monday night. The loss ends the season for the Eaglettes (10-11)...

  • No cheers for state, TSSAA (12/30/20)
    On Monday, Governor Bill Lee signed Executive Order No. 70, which goes into effect through January 19. The executive order directly impacts athletics during the ongoing pandemic. The past few weeks have seen a distinct surge in COVID-19 cases and as such, the governor directly addressed the possible exposure point of high school athletics...
